Staffordshire flatback figures are earthenware ceramic ornaments produced in England during the 19th century, designed with a flat rear surface to sit flush against a fireplace mantelpiece. They depicted popular cultural subjects, historical figures, folklore themes, and regional characters of the Victorian era.

These figures were cast in press moulds using earthenware clay, leaving a hollow interior to reduce weight and production costs. After firing, they received a lead glaze and were hand-painted with overglaze enamel colours and gilded details.

Authentic Victorian examples typically feature a flat, undecorated back with a small pressure-release vent hole, a hollow base, and signs of craquelure in the lead glaze. They rarely bear makers marks, as they were mass-produced folk pottery for working and middle-class households.

Display these figures on a fireplace mantelpiece, open bookshelf, or console table alongside natural wood finishes, framed botanical prints, and woven textiles. Grouping multiple figures of varying heights creates a curated, traditional focal point in modern country or eclectic spaces.

Dust the figure gently with a soft dry microfibre brush or cloth, avoiding harsh chemical cleaners or submersion in water which can damage overglaze enamels. Ensure the piece is kept away from direct moisture and extreme temperature fluctuations to protect delicate glazes.
